Chronological age
Chronological age is the most straightforward and commonly used measure of a person's age. It is simply the number of years that have passed since the date of their birth. Chronological age is often used for official purposes, such as determining eligibility for certain benefits or legal responsibilities. It is also commonly used in everyday conversation to describe a person's age, such as when we say "Melina is 30 years old."
- Facet 1: Objective and quantifiable: Chronological age is an objective and quantifiable measure of age. It is not subject to interpretation or opinion, and it can be easily calculated using a calendar. This makes it a reliable and useful way to measure age for many purposes.
- Facet 2: Legal and social significance: Chronological age has significant legal and social implications. In most countries, chronological age is used to determine eligibility for certain rights and responsibilities, such as the right to vote, the right to drive, and the age of majority. Chronological age is also used to determine eligibility for various social programs and benefits, such as Social Security and Medicare.
- Facet 3: Limitations: While chronological age is a useful measure of age, it does have some limitations. For example, chronological age does not always reflect a person's physical or mental health. A 60-year-old person may be in excellent health and have the physical and mental capacity of a much younger person. Conversely, a 20-year-old person may have a chronic illness that makes them appear and feel much older than their chronological age.
Overall, chronological age is a valuable measure of age that has many important uses. However, it is important to be aware of its limitations and to consider other factors, such as physical and mental health, when making decisions about a person's age.
Biological age
Biological age is a measure of the overall health and functioning of a person's body. It is based on an assessment of a variety of factors, including physical fitness, organ function, and immune response. Biological age is often used to predict a person's risk of developing certain diseases and to estimate their overall life expectancy.
- Facet 1: Relationship to chronological age
Biological age and chronological age are not always the same. A person may have a biological age that is older or younger than their chronological age. For example, a person who is 50 years old may have a biological age of 60 if they have poor health and fitness. Conversely, a person who is 70 years old may have a biological age of 50 if they are in excellent health and fitness.
- Facet 2: Factors that influence biological age
A number of factors can influence biological age, including genetics, lifestyle, and environment. Genes play a role in determining a person's overall health and longevity. However, lifestyle choices, such as diet, exercise, and smoking, can also have a significant impact on biological age. Exposure to environmental toxins and pollutants can also accelerate biological aging.

- Facet 4: Applications of biological age
Biological age is used in a variety of applications, including health care, life insurance, and anti-aging research. In health care, biological age can be used to predict a person's risk of developing certain diseases and to guide treatment decisions. In life insurance, biological age can be used to assess a person's life expectancy and to set insurance rates. In anti-aging research, biological age is used to identify factors that contribute to aging and to develop strategies to slow down the aging process.

Cultural age
The cultural age of a person refers to the customs and traditions of their culture, which can shape their values and beliefs about age. This can have a significant impact on how a person perceives and experiences aging, as well as how they are perceived and treated by others.
- Facet 1: Age-related expectations and norms
Different cultures have different expectations and norms about how people should behave at different ages. For example, in some cultures, it is expected that older adults will retire from work and spend their time caring for their grandchildren. In other cultures, older adults are expected to remain active and engaged in their communities. These expectations can influence how people view themselves and their place in society as they age.
- Facet 2: Age-related social roles
In many cultures, age is associated with specific social roles and responsibilities. For example, in some cultures, older adults are seen as the keepers of tradition and wisdom, and they are consulted for advice and guidance. In other cultures, older adults are seen as less capable and less valuable than younger people, and they may be marginalized or excluded from decision-making processes.
- Facet 3: Age-related stereotypes
Many cultures have stereotypes about older adults, such as the belief that they are all frail, forgetful, and out of touch with the modern world. These stereotypes can lead to discrimination against older adults and can make it difficult for them to participate fully in society.
- Facet 4: Age-related rituals and celebrations
Many cultures have rituals and celebrations that are associated with different stages of life, including aging. For example, in some cultures, there are coming-of-age ceremonies that mark the transition from childhood to adulthood. In other cultures, there are retirement ceremonies that mark the transition from work to retirement. These rituals and celebrations can help people to mark the passage of time and to make sense of their changing roles and identities as they age.
